码迷,mamicode.com
首页 >  
搜索关键字:数组和指针    ( 224个结果
实验13——结构体、文件的基本应用
1、本次课学习到的知识点: (1)像数组和指针一样,结构也是一种构造数据类型,它与数组的区别在于:数组中所有元素的数据类型必须是相同的,而结构中各成员的数据类型可以不同。 (2)struct 结构名{ 类型名 结构成员名1; 类型名 结构成员名2; ··· 类姓名 结构成员名n; }; struct ...
分类:其他好文   时间:2016-12-24 13:58:40    阅读次数:163
《C专家编程》第四章——令人震惊的事实:数组和指针并不相同
数组和指针是C语言里相当重要的两部分内容,也是新手程序员最容易搞混的两个地方,本章我们锁定指针与数组,探讨它们的异同点。 首先来看指针与数组在声明上的区别: int a[10]; int *p; 很明显的,第一个是数组a,第二个是指针p。下一个问题是a的类型是什么?p的类型是什么?a[0]的类型是i ...
分类:编程语言   时间:2016-12-24 01:38:02    阅读次数:270
C语言核心之数组和指针详解
指针 相信大家对下面的代码不陌生: int i=2; int *p; p=&i;这是最简单的指针应用,也是最基本的用法。再来熟悉一下什么是指针:首先指针是一个变量,它保存的并不是平常的数据,而是变量的地址。如上代码,指针p中保存的是整型变量i的地址信息。 接下来看如何定义一个指针,既然指针也是一个变 ...
分类:编程语言   时间:2016-12-11 07:58:20    阅读次数:181
数组和指针(2)----指针调用函数
#include <stdio.h>#include<stdlib.h>int add(int a, int b){ return a + b;}int Max(int a, int b){ int i; i=a > b ? a : b; return i;}int main(){ //指针指向函数 ...
分类:编程语言   时间:2016-11-19 01:28:09    阅读次数:221
C学习笔记 知识集锦(二)
1. 数组和指针 2. 字符串赋值 3. memset&memcpy 4. 机器数和真值,原码,反码和补码 5. 文件指针和文件描述符 6. 内存泄露和内存损坏 7. 什么是不可移植的程序 8. 动态库文件和静态库文件 9. make的行为 10. 库函数调用和系统调用 数组和指针 数组:同类型的数 ...
分类:其他好文   时间:2016-11-15 17:00:23    阅读次数:273
C语言结构体里的成员数组和指针
参考:http://developer.51cto.com/art/201404/434678_all.htm 我觉得楼主的观点(访问成员指针其实是相对地址里的内容)在结构体指针为null时是成立的,当结构体指针不为null时(如上的例子),访问成员指针得到的其实是成员指针指向的内容。 ...
分类:编程语言   时间:2016-10-28 09:45:02    阅读次数:242
数组和指针的联系
1.数组的本质是一段连续的内存空间2.数组的空间大小为sizeof(array_type)*array_size3.数组名可看做指向数组第一个元素的常量指针4.指针是一种特殊的变量,与整数的运算规则为:p+n;=(unsignedint)p+n*sizeof(*p);结论:当指针p指向一个桶类型的数组的元素时;p+1将指向当前元..
分类:编程语言   时间:2016-10-05 01:12:38    阅读次数:216
C++数组和指针加减法和sizeof问题
关于指针和加减法: 指针的加减法:指针的加减法,加多少或者减多少,主要是看所指对象的sizeof值。 例子: 如上图所示,p加了8,因为指向是double类型。p1加了4,因为指向了int。 现在我定义一个数组,int a[3]={0};看一下a+1和&a+1到底加了多少: p+1加了4,&p+1加 ...
分类:编程语言   时间:2016-09-19 19:19:22    阅读次数:154
C语言结构体里的成员数组和指针
本文通过阅读陈皓的文章总结http://coolshell.cn/articles/11377.html1、所谓变量只是内存中抽象的一个名字,在静态编译时都会转换成相应的内存地址,我们的变量都会在编译的时候被编译器放入内存区中2、当访问结构体成员变量的时候,是通过偏移量来寻找的不管结构体的实例是什..
分类:编程语言   时间:2016-09-11 15:40:57    阅读次数:224
C Primer Plus_第10章_数组和指针_编程练习
1. 2. 3. 4. 5. 6. 7. 8. 突然发现自己写的程序自己都不愿意去读,因为全是代码没有模块化的注释,仅仅偶尔有个细节注释啥的,所以看起来要找,要想,这一段函数是干什么的,实现某个功能的函数在哪里等等。本来程序就是密密麻麻的东西,而且又不是汉语形式的,本身看起来就很费劲。所以还是要多写 ...
分类:编程语言   时间:2016-09-08 00:42:10    阅读次数:273
224条   上一页 1 ... 7 8 9 10 11 ... 23 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!